Robert Johnson was the original "unplugged" star - an impassioned master of the blues whose life and death were shrouded in mystery. His playing and singing have burned themselves into the memories of every musician who has heard them, and in the 1960s, cut sharply across the developing foundations of rock and roll. Here, finally, Scott Ainslie presents a video lesson devoted to Johnson's work: this is where part of the mystery ends.Here in his first video Ainslie teaches seven of Johnson's greatest pieces. Condensing more than a decade of blues teaching, performing and research on Johnson's guitar style, Ainslie delivers a startlingly concise and accessible demonstration of the techniques Johnson used to create his remarkable gutiar parts. In this video, you will travel to the crossroads of the Delta Blues with a contemporary master and learn to play. (60 minutes)
